What is friendship
friendship is a beautiful and meaningful relationship between two individuals who share a deep emotional connection, trust, and mutual support. It's a bond between people who:

  • Care for each other's well-being and happiness
  • Share common interests, values, and experiences
  • Trust and rely on each other
  • Communicate openly and honestly
  • Support each other through life's ups and downs
  • Accept and appreciate each other's differences
  • Enjoy each other's company and share laughter and fun times

Friendship brings numerous benefits, including:

  • Emotional support and comfort
  • Sense of belonging and connection
  • Opportunities for personal growth and learning
  • Shared experiences and memories
  • Improved mental and physical health
  • Increased happiness and fulfillment

At its core, friendship is about:

  • Being there for each other
  • Caring about each other's feelings and well-being
  • Sharing life's journey together
  • Creating meaningful memories and experiences
  • Providing a sense of belonging and connection

Overall, friendship is a precious and valuable relationship that enriches our lives and brings joy, support, and meaning to our existence.

Nurturing a strong and lasting friendship takes effort, commitment, and dedication. Here are some tips to help you maintain a healthy and fulfilling friendship:

  • Communicate openly and honestly: Share your thoughts, feelings, and experiences with each other. Listen actively and respond with empathy and understanding.

  • Spend quality time together: Regularly schedule time to hang out, go on adventures, or simply enjoy each other's company.

  • Show appreciation and gratitude: Express thanks for your friend's presence in your life and celebrate their achievements.

  • Respect boundaries: Recognize and honor each other's individuality, needs, and limits.

  • Support each other through life's ups and downs: Be a rock for your friend during challenging times and celebrate their successes.

  • Forgive and forget: Let go of grudges and resentments, and work towards moving forward together.

  • Make time for regular check-ins: Stay connected and updated on each other's lives, even when life gets busy.

  • Show interest in each other's passions: Support and encourage your friend's hobbies, interests, and goals.

  • Be reliable and dependable: Follow through on commitments and be someone your friend can count on.

  • Laugh together often: Share humor and joy to keep your friendship light-hearted and fun.

By following these tips, you can nurture a strong, supportive, and lifelong friendship that brings joy and fulfillment to your life.
